Transaction 3c7324112e323234c998d6b82f33ae6667a7577e01c15a0fcae227b07caf192a

2 Input
2 Outputs
  • 3c7324112e323234c998d6b82f33ae6667a7577e01c15a0fcae227b07caf192a:0
  • value  7196657
    address  18XYbvJnFLqH7xHeUYg8yXC7Vdnsk7T2eN
  • 3c7324112e323234c998d6b82f33ae6667a7577e01c15a0fcae227b07caf192a:1
  • value  4373040
    address  18vabZgKs4UCoxGnE3Vx54yDgDdcpGhaJL